# Dear Debbie From the acclaimed author of The Housemaid comes a darkly clever thriller that explores what happens when patience runs out. Debbie Mullen has built her reputation dispensing wisdom through her syndicated advice column, where New England wives seek counsel on their troubled marriages. For years, she's counseled women trapped in neglectful or harmful relationships, offering guidance with compassion and care. But Debbie's own world is unraveling. Recently fired from her position, she's watching her teenage daughters slip further away while her husband conceals truths—discoveries that only her phone tracker can confirm. The woman who once preached restraint and reason has reached her breaking point. No longer content to model composure, Debbie decides to become the architect of her own justice. She's ready to reclaim agency by holding accountable those who've wronged her, armed with the same insights she once shared freely with others. What unfolds is a provocative examination of feminine power unleashed—a riveting tale about women who refuse to suffer in silence any longer.
